I walked the first half of Camino Frances last September and had to stop in Carrion de los Condes. The travel to Valladolid airport from this point was easy. This summer I am planning to start where I stopped, but today I am not able to find flights to Valladolid with Ryan air. Valladolid was on the map and on the list of airports, but I was not able to find any prices or timetables. Does anybody know if they have stopped flying to this destination? Or perhaps they have some problems with their website...
Are there any other easy (and cheap ;-) ) ways to travel to Carrion de los Condes?

If you can get a cheap Ryanair flight from Haugesund to London Stansted then you may be able to travel on to Valladolid also with Ryanair. No idea if the timetables coincide but worth a look. Also Easyjet fly out of Stansted to various Spanish airports ie Santiago de Compostela, Oviedo and Bilbao - again you will need to do a bit of research to see how easy the rest of your journey would be. Obviously the sooner you book the cheaper it is.
